The industrial dimensional metrology equipment market, valued at $1254 million in 2025, is poised for robust growth,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.6%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is driven by several key factors. Increasing automation across various industries, particularly automotive, aerospace, and electronics manufacturing, fuels the demand for precise and efficient measurement solutions. The rising adoption of advanced technologies like 3D scanning, laser measurement, and computer-aided inspection (CAI) is further accelerating market growth. Furthermore, stringent quality control requirements and the need for improved product accuracy are compelling factors. The market is witnessing a shift towards smart manufacturing and Industry 4.0 principles, which necessitates the integration of advanced metrology equipment within interconnected production systems. This trend demands sophisticated, data-driven solutions offering real-time feedback and enhanced process optimization.
Despite the positive outlook, the market faces some challenges. High initial investment costs associated with advanced metrology equipment can hinder adoption, especially for smaller businesses. The complexity of some systems requires specialized training and expertise, potentially limiting widespread implementation. However, the long-term benefits in terms of improved product quality, reduced waste, and increased efficiency outweigh these challenges. The market is segmented by equipment type (e.g., coordinate measuring machines (CMMs), optical scanners, laser trackers), application (e.g., automotive, aerospace, medical), and region. Key players like KEYENCE, Mitutoyo, and Hexagon are leading the market, constantly innovating to meet the evolving needs of industries. Several key factors are propelling the growth of the industrial dimensional metrology equipment market. The relentless pursuit of higher precision and quality in manufacturing is a primary driver, pushing companies to invest in advanced metrology solutions to minimize defects and improve overall product quality. The rise of automation in manufacturing processes is another significant factor, as automated metrology systems are crucial for integrating quality control seamlessly into production lines. Increased adoption of Industry 4.0 technologies and the associated need for real-time data analysis for process optimization and predictive maintenance contribute substantially. The growing demand for advanced materials and complex geometries in various industries, including aerospace and medical devices, necessitates the use of sophisticated metrology equipment capable of accurately measuring intricate shapes and features. Furthermore, stringent regulatory compliance requirements in sectors like automotive and aerospace, emphasizing precision and traceability, are compelling manufacturers to adopt advanced metrology techniques. Finally, the development of innovative metrology technologies, such as AI-powered defect detection and advanced sensor technologies, is enhancing the capabilities and efficiency of these systems, thus driving market growth.
Despite the positive outlook, the industrial dimensional metrology equipment market faces certain challenges. The high initial investment cost associated with advanced metrology systems can be a barrier for smaller manufacturers, particularly in developing economies. The complexity of operating and maintaining some of these sophisticated technologies requires skilled personnel, leading to potential skill shortages in certain regions. The need for continuous calibration and validation to ensure accuracy adds to the operational costs. Furthermore, the rapid pace of technological advancements necessitates frequent upgrades, potentially leading to higher expenditure for companies. Competition in the market is also intense, with several established players and new entrants vying for market share. This competitive landscape can lead to price pressures. Finally, the cyclical nature of some manufacturing industries can impact demand for metrology equipment, causing fluctuations in market growth. Addressing these challenges requires collaboration between equipment manufacturers, technology providers, and end-users to develop more affordable, user-friendly, and easily maintainable metrology solutions.
North America: The region's established manufacturing base, particularly in automotive and aerospace, fuels significant demand for high-precision metrology equipment. Advanced technologies and a focus on quality control contribute to this dominance.
Europe: Similar to North America, Europe has a mature industrial sector with stringent quality standards. The automotive, aerospace, and medical device industries in particular drive substantial demand.
Asia-Pacific: This region is witnessing rapid industrialization, particularly in China and India, boosting demand for metrology equipment, especially in sectors like electronics and consumer goods. Cost-effective solutions are gaining traction here.
